Building a Spin the Wheel Game: HTML, CSS, and JavaScript Basics
Building a Spin the Wheel Game: HTML, CSS, and JavaScript Basics
Blog Article
Creating an appealing "spin the wheel" game online can be an amazing job, particularly if you're wanting to incorporate it right into competitions, giveaways, or interactive experiences on your site. This article will certainly direct you through the basics of establishing your own spin the wheel ready free, total with a JavaScript wheel animation tutorial, pointers for establishing a customizable wheel generator, and guidance for picking winners in giveaways.
A spin the wheel game is an aesthetically enticing, interactive tool that not just captivates users however can also drive interaction and increase communication on your site. Many companies and content makers make use of spin the wheel games as a method to record emails, advertise items, or simply provide enjoyable experiences to their target markets. While various systems give ready-made spin the wheel themes, developing your very own variation can be a fulfilling venture that enables customization and creative thinking.
To obtain started, you'll need a fundamental understanding of how HTML, CSS, and JavaScript job, as these are the foundational modern technologies you'll use to build the spin the wheel game. When users spin the wheel, it ought to come to a quit at one of these segments, revealing the prize they've won.
Using JavaScript for the wheel animation is where the magic takes place. To carry out the spinning impact, you'll create a function that progressively turns the wheel image around its facility factor. By calculating rotation angles and applying CSS changes, you can create a smooth rotating animation that finishes in a small bounce result upon quiting. This bounce not only makes the animation extra aesthetically interesting yet likewise enhances the expectancy for the result. Making use of the requestAnimationFrame() technique can guarantee your computer animations run smoothly and responsively throughout all tools.
As you established up the game mechanics, consider how customers will start the spin. You can offer a large, attractive switch labeled "Spin" that reacts visually when floated over or clicked. As soon as the individual clicks the switch to spin the wheel, you can cause your defined spinning functions, including randomized estimations that set the stopping angle, factoring in both the sections' weights and a little component of opportunity to make it exciting and fair. Digital games are frequently boosted by integrating noises, and including a rotating sound complied with by a congratulatory tune when a prize is won can substantially enhance customer experience.
A customizable wheel generator can boost your spin the wheel game by permitting you to create various wheels for different celebrations or target markets. This can be done by permitting customers to customize the sections on the wheel, change the shades, and also submit their own photos for the rewards. You can integrate an admin panel where users can specify the variety of segments, input their reward listing, readjust shades according to their branding, and preview the wheel before running it. Moreover, offering options for designs, such as a sleek modern-day style versus a playful cartoonish wheel, can bring in a larger target market and make your wheel a lot more available for different occasions-- be get more info it business giveaways, birthday celebration parties, or area events.
In terms of how to choose giveaway winners, a spin the wheel game makes it visually attractive and uncomplicated. You can have users register for the giveaway-- probably requiring an email or social media comply with-- and then spin the wheel during a live online event or through your site. If you're doing this as component of an online stream, the real-time communication can enhance the excitement and aid viewers feel component of the process, making your giveaway more unforgettable.
To keep justness in champion option, ensure that the wheel precisely represents the odds of each section's reward. For free gifts with several prizes, each section must show its equivalent chance. As an example, if you have one grand prize and five smaller prizes, the larger prize should clearly take up much less percent of the wheel. Transparency in how the winners are selected develops depend on with your audience and boosts their interaction.
An additional essential facet is to think of data collection and analytics. By incorporating your spin the wheel game with tools like Google Analytics or details CRM systems, you can track user communications, gather email addresses, and establish the success of your campaigns. This information not only provides important understandings into what rewards or experiences excite your audience yet can also help you fine-tune your offerings in future video games.
Think about promoting your spin the wheel game via numerous channels. In addition, think about incentivizing referrals-- providing users added rotates or entries if they successfully refer their close friends can improve website your game's popularity and reach.
To involve individuals efficiently, guarantee you likewise incorporate a follow-up after the game finishes. Send individualized thank-you messages to participants, share their winnings on social media sites, and announce brand-new events-- maintaining the neighborhood involved long after the preliminary excitement has actually subsided. This not just enhances individual get more info retention but can likewise transform single participants into dedicated fans.
In summary, developing a spin the wheel game online can be a gratifying venture that combines creativity, technical abilities, and customer communication. Whether it's for free gifts, contests, or just as a fun interactive attribute, a spin the wheel game can enhance your online existence and mesmerize your visitors.